大为股份(002213) - 2014 Q3 - 季度财报
2014-10-28 16:00
Financial Performance - Operating revenue decreased by 31.42% year-on-year to CNY 54,456,024.46 for the current period[7] - Net profit attributable to shareholders decreased by 58.97% to CNY 3,498,610.47 compared to the same period last year[7] - Basic earnings per share fell by 58.54% to CNY 0.017[7] - Net profit decreased by ¥6,008,794.89, down 32.21%, due to a reduction in revenue and an increase in expenses[15] - The estimated net profit attributable to shareholders for 2014 is expected to range from 11.05 million to 19.34 million CNY, representing a decrease of 30% to 60% compared to the previous year's net profit of 27.63 million CNY[20] - The decline in net profit is attributed to the impact of national policies on the new energy vehicle industry, leading to a decrease in sales of traditional energy buses and related products[20] - The company is expected to maintain a positive net profit for 2014, indicating no turnaround from a loss situation[20] Cash Flow - Cash flow from operating activities showed a significant decline of 170.11%, totaling CNY -20,002,496.61[7] - The net cash flow from operating activities decreased by ¥48,530,767.35, a decline of 170.11%, due to lower cash receipts from sales compared to the previous year[15] - The net cash flow from investing activities increased by ¥61,631,969.71, up 175.76%, due to the recovery of investments from matured financial products[15] Assets and Liabilities - Total assets increased by 5.38% to CNY 471,179,337.52 compared to the end of the previous year[7] - The company's trading financial assets decreased by ¥30,052,356.16, a reduction of 30% due to the maturity of principal-protected financial products purchased last year[15] - Accounts receivable increased by ¥43,815,625.41, up 60.51%, attributed to a decrease in the amount paid with notes[15] - Inventory rose by ¥25,423,213.15, an increase of 57.97%, as the company prepared stock for fourth-quarter shipments[15] - Other receivables increased by ¥1,494,771.39, up 104.36%, due to an increase in employee petty cash[15] - The company’s accounts payable increased by ¥34,154,001.18, a rise of 143.41%, due to an increase in payments made with self-issued notes[15] Shareholder Information - The number of ordinary shareholders at the end of the reporting period was 13,543[11] - The top shareholder, Ling Zhaowei, holds 19.89% of shares, totaling 40,966,400 shares, with 30,600,000 shares pledged[11] Investments and Adjustments - The company has made an investment adjustment, transferring a long-term equity investment valued at 20 million CNY to available-for-sale financial assets as per revised accounting standards[22] - The company acquired an additional 1% stake in Shenzhen Century Botong Investment Co., increasing its ownership to 100%, resulting in a reduction of minority interests by approximately 425,522.93 CNY[22] - The company has not engaged in any securities investments during the reporting period[21] Commitments and Guarantees - The company has committed to covering any potential losses related to housing fund contributions for its Shenzhen employees, ensuring no financial impact on the company[19] - The company has not reported any unfulfilled commitments during the reporting period[19] - The company’s major shareholders have provided a guarantee to cover any liabilities related to housing fund contributions[19]

Financial Performance - The company's operating revenue for 2013 was CNY 327,428,094.45, representing a 15.93% increase compared to CNY 282,440,058.84 in 2012[20]. - The net profit attributable to shareholders for 2013 was CNY 27,628,495.45, a decrease of 11.7% from CNY 31,288,919.75 in 2012[20]. - The net cash flow from operating activities increased significantly by 225.07% to CNY 68,167,598.40 from CNY 20,969,973.08 in 2012[20]. - The total assets at the end of 2013 were CNY 447,124,806.37, reflecting a 5.24% increase from CNY 424,879,687.29 at the end of 2012[20]. - The net assets attributable to shareholders increased by 5.4% to CNY 338,276,262.83 from CNY 320,947,767.38 in 2012[20]. - The basic earnings per share for 2013 were CNY 0.13, down 13.33% from CNY 0.15 in 2012[20]. - The weighted average return on equity for 2013 was 8.36%, a decrease of 1.72% from 10.08% in 2012[20]. - The company achieved an operating revenue of 327,428,094.45 yuan in 2013, representing a year-on-year growth of 15.93%[28]. - Main business income increased by 19.74% year-on-year, amounting to 316,616,095.89 yuan, which accounted for 96.70% of total revenue[27][28]. - The company's net profit attributable to shareholders decreased by 11.70% year-on-year, totaling 2,762.85 yuan[26]. Cash Flow and Investments - The net cash flow from operating activities increased by 225.07% year-on-year, primarily due to an increase in cash received from sales and a decrease in cash paid for purchases[37]. - Cash and cash equivalents increased by 85.60% year-on-year, influenced by the aforementioned factors[37]. - The company reported a significant decrease in cash inflow from investment activities, down 97.12% year-on-year[37]. - The company plans to invest 5,000 in a routine production project, with 657.7 already spent, but has not yet generated any revenue from this investment[54]. - The company reported a cancellation of external investment by Century Botong on June 26, 2013[89]. Market and Product Information - The company faces market risks due to its reliance on a single product, the automotive electric retarder, which limits its ability to withstand industry changes[11]. - The company sold 38,540 units of automotive retarders, a year-on-year increase of 17.99%[28]. - The inventory of retarders increased by 90% compared to the previous year, attributed to the rise in undelivered quantities[28]. - The market for automotive auxiliary braking products is expected to expand in 2014, particularly in the market for buses under 9 meters and trucks[55]. - The company operates in the automotive parts manufacturing industry, focusing on the development and sales of electromechanical equipment and braking products[184].
